Tu'anuku is a village on the western part of Vava'u, . It has several nicknames such as Toa-ko-Tavakefai'ana, Halapukepuke, Hala-siki-'o-Mata'aho and also Uini-e-Ngofe. is situated 8 km northwest of Nukulahanga.

is the second-largest town in with a population of 3,845 in 2021. It is situated beside the Port of Refuge, a deep-water harbour on the south coast of , the main island of the Vavaʻu archipelago in northern Tonga. is situated 8 km north of Nukulahanga.
